Revenge is a dish best served with a vintage Riesling.
Former Boston detective Mave moved to the coastal village of Bracken Cove for the "slow lane." She imagined a life of artisanal lattes, tide-pooling with her four-year-old, and listening to her husband deconstruct Victorian literature. She didn't plan on the murder rate being higher than the caffeine content.
When Larsen Whitmore—the town's arrogant, Michelin-star-chasing chef—is found dead at the base of Skylark Bluff, the locals are quick to call it a tragic suicide. But Mave spots what the village gossip mill missed: a thermos of herbal tea spiked with a heavy sedative, and a car door left wide open like an invitation.
Larsen was a man who collected enemies like he collected vintage wines. There's the manic PTA president whose catering contract he canceled; the desperate diner owner with a gambling debt; and the struggling single mom he publicly humiliated.
But as Mave peels back the layers of Harbor Green's polite society, she realizes the killer isn't the person with the loudest grudge—it's the one with the most to lose.
In a town where the "perfect pairing" is a matter of life and death, Mave must catch a killer before the next course is served.
